### Key Ceremony — Step 4: Quota Signer for TideMeter

Heads up, support folks: TideMeter enforces per-tenant rate quotas, and quota overrides are signed so tenants can't forge them. During the ceremony we rotate the override-signing key. Your part is simple — verify the two witnesses have signed the paper log, snap a photo of the sealed envelope, and file it. When it's your turn at the console, type in the passphrase below.

unlock words, fafop-hawep: briwyn-oliix-sorox

Subject: Key rotation — Pixelbin cache leak

New folks: quick context. The Pixelbin image cache had a memory leak in its eviction loop. It held decoded frames past TTL, and heap growth eventually forced restarts on the Harlow cluster. Patch shipped last night; restarts are done.

Because the old process dumped heap snapshots to shared storage, we're rotating the Pixelbin service key as a precaution. Old key dies Friday noon. Update your local env before then. The new key for the Pixelbin internal API is below.

gateway credential: kto3_qfe

Q: How is access restored if the Liftrunner elevator-dispatch simulator's encrypted scenario store becomes inaccessible? A: The store holds proprietary dispatch algorithms and building topology fixtures, so it auto-locks after repeated failed decrypts. Recovery is deliberately manual: a reviewer-approved operator runs the unseal utility from the simulator host, confirms the lock event in the audit trail, and supplies the standing recovery passphrase. For audit completeness, that passphrase is documented immediately below.

strongbox words: sorir-belvan-rusix-ulays-ralmir-praix-eliir-tamax-praael-druael-julir-tamius-jorir

## Temporary Site Access — Harwick House Renovation

While the Calderline Building is under renovation, all staff and deliveries are routed through the temporary site at Harwick House, two doors down. Reception operates from the ground-floor annexe between 07:30 and 18:00. The main lift is out of service; use the east stairwell. The side door stays locked at all times and requires the pass code below.

staff pass of yageg-fafog = bdg-A-76